2012-10-12 76 views
1

我正在嘗試使用Monkey Talk進行自動測試。我成功安裝了它。我在Eclipse Juno上運行示例應用程序,然後創建一個新的猴腳本並記錄操作。 問題是Monkey IDE不會在設備或模擬器上記錄我的操作。我嘗試了他們兩個,但沒有幸運。怎麼修?Monkey Talk IDE不記錄動作

Eclipse Juno,Ubuntu OS。當通過設備的IP地址連接到我的設備

I followed this tutorial video.

截圖。

enter image description here

回答

2

你應該確保猴子通話的Android劑添加到您的libs文件夾,還您項目轉換爲AspectJ的。

+0

當然,我做到了。我讀了Monkey Talk論壇。這是Ubuntu中衆所周知的問題。 – Emerald214

0

我有與iOS模擬器或設備相同的問題,但是當我重新啓動猴子IDE它配置連接到您的設備,一秒鐘後啓用錄音功能。祝你好運

0

你必須以管理員權限運行Monkey Talk IDE。

0

你首先必須使您的應用程序的源代碼通過下面的步驟與Monkeytalk兼容,比之後就可以自動執行它的步驟是:大猩猩邏輯網站

  1. 下載MonkeyTalk並解壓縮。

  2. 打開Eclipse和轉換的「切面」項目(需要插件的AspectJ - 月食) - 一旦獲得下載用鼠標右鍵單擊您的應用程序,配置,轉換爲AspectJ的。

  3. 然後在您的項目文件夾結構下搜索「libs」文件夾如果它存在然後確定否則創建它。

  4. 一旦完成,請轉至monkeytalk,agents,android,Monkeytalkjar文件。將其複製並粘貼到libs文件夾下。

  5. 完成後單擊「jar」文件並右鍵單擊它,Aspectjtools,添加到縱向路徑。

  6. 然後轉到Androidmanifest.xml文件,我們必須添加一些權限;

    <Uses-permissions android:name="android.Permission.INTERNET/>

    <Uses-permissions android:name="android.Permission.Get_TASKS/>

並保存。

  • 轉到項目點擊它,右擊,屬性,JavaBuild路徑,勾選「AspectJ運行庫,OK。

  • 運行應用程序的Android應用程序。

  • 打開猴談話。

  • 創建新項目,創建新的腳本。

  • 然後在prefences下設置android sdk路徑; MonkeyTalk,MonketTalkPrefences,Android SDK路徑,確定。

  • 連接到monkeytalk上的模擬器。

  • 現在您將能夠在MonkeyTalk中錄製和播放。

    一些啓動代碼供您參考,例如:如果我們有兩個文本框用戶名和密碼和一個按鈕提交。

    app.input("username").entertext("aakash"); 
    
    app.input("password").entertext("jaiswal"); 
    
    app.button("submit").tap(); 
    
    0

    這是我如何成功做到

    1)看到的應該是(幫助 - >關於ADT或Eclipse版本)(幫助 - >關於Eclipse)

    2)獲得url AspectJ的從這個網址https://eclipse.org/ajdt/downloads/

    3)轉到幫助 - >安裝新軟件,並添加路徑

    安裝軟件和享受!查看詳細幫助視頻:https://www.youtube.com/watch?v=EJMUgOrffFY

    4)添加猴談話jar文件在libs文件夾,如果沒有在你的項目庫文件夾,使一個並添加monkeytalk jar文件是在您下載

    的zip文件夾

    5)增加其添加到構建路徑或右鍵單擊猴子說話罐子aspectpath

    6)中的manifest.xml添加權限android.permission.INTERNET對 android.permission.GET_TASKS

    7)然後轉到我們所在的AndroidManifest.xml文件已經添加了一些權限;

    並保存。

    8)轉到項目點擊它,右擊,屬性,JavaBuild路徑,勾選「AspectJ運行庫,OK。

    9)運行應用程序。

    10)打開猴談話IDE 。

    11)創建新的項目和腳本文件。

    12)設置SDK路徑,並設置連接到仿真器

    12)單擊連接ŧ Ø模擬器或設備

    現在你可以看到記錄按鈕啓用,詳見本https://www.cloudmonkeymobile.com/monkeytalk-documentation/monkeytalk-getting-started/install-agent/android

    希望它能幫助,請隨時問,如果有什麼是仍然沒有工作。